Common Emergency Situation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ency dental solutions typically include treatments such as extractions, fillings, and origin canals, each with differing connected expenses. Removals, where a tooth is removed, can range from $75 to $450 per tooth depending upon the intricacy. For chipped teeth, the price can differ from $100 to $1000 depending upon the extent. Oral crowns, used to cover broken teeth, usually cost between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Repairing a broken tooth might range from $100 to $1000.

Keep in mind that these prices can fluctuate based upon variables like the dental practitioner's experience, location, and the complexity of the treatment. Comprehending the potential rates of common emergency oral treatments can much better prepare you for taking care of unanticipated dental expenses.
